Vimwiki

Vimwiki is a personal wiki for Vim -- a number of linked text files that have their own syntax highlighting.

With Vimwiki you can:
* organize notes and ideas
* manage todo-lists
* write documentation
* maintain a diary
* export everything to HTML

Vimwiki is installed as a Vim plugin, and available on every platform where you can run Vim: Linux, Windows (gVim), Mac (MacVim), Android (DroidVim), ...
All the data is stored on the local machine in a text-based format, making this wiki private and future proof (editable/readable manually with any text editor).
Synchronization is possible with any online sync service (Dropbox/OneDrive/etc...) or version control system (Git, Subversion, ...).

Zim

Zim

FreeOpen SourceMacWindowsLinuxBSD

Zim brings the concept of a wiki to your desktop. Store information, link pages and edit with WYSISYG markup or directly typing some lightweight markup syntax and see it...
